Staff Software Engineer

Carta Carta · Fintech · London, United Kingdom · Engineering

Staff Software Engineer at Carta, focusing on building AI agents for document ingestion and processing within enterprise ERP solutions for private capital markets. The role involves leading technical direction, navigating ambiguity, championing systemic improvements, and defining standards for safe and effective AI tool usage across the organization.

What you'd actually do

  1. Define the AI Frontier: Lead the charge in transforming how we build by defining the context and building the rails that allow every person at Carta to leverage AI tools safely and effectively. You’ll help move the organization toward a future where AI amplifies our collective engineering impact.
  2. AI-Driven Data Ingestion, Processing and Analytics: Accelerating the modernization of private capital markets by integrating advanced AI-powered data ingestion, extraction and analytics.
  3. You will help build AI agents that automate document ingestion into data processing pipelines, making portfolio information more accessible, accurate, and actionable for investors and fund managers across our unified platform.
  4. Navigate Ambiguity: Tackle the most complex and poorly defined problems at Carta, breaking them down into navigable paths for the rest of the organization.
  5. Champion Systemic Improvement: Identify and eliminate failure patterns across multiple systems, driving architectural changes that improve scalability and reliability.

Skills

Required

  • Expert in building distributed systems
  • 10+ years of professional software engineering experience
  • High-level technical leadership
  • Python/Django
  • React
  • Postgres
  • JVM languages
  • gRPC
  • cloud-native infrastructure (AWS)

What the JD emphasized

  • AI agents
  • AI tools

Other signals

  • AI-driven data ingestion, processing and analytics
  • build AI agents that automate document ingestion
  • Define the AI Frontier
  • leverage AI tools safely and effectively